• Joined on 2026-04-18
sascha pushed to main at sascha/pfannkuchen 2026-04-24 22:16:23 +02:00
0843987f0a cleanup: remove dead proxy/ stack (compose.yaml)
sascha pushed to main at sascha/pfannkuchen 2026-04-24 22:15:24 +02:00
e0b4b10c66 cleanup: remove dead proxy/ stack (old geister-config)
sascha pushed to main at sascha/proxy 2026-04-24 18:58:48 +02:00
345b8fc3cb Initial: Caddy reverse proxy stack
sascha created repository sascha/proxy 2026-04-24 18:57:36 +02:00
sascha pushed to main at sascha/pfannkuchen 2026-04-24 17:54:04 +02:00
26f757bc32 Add git.sascha-lutz.de to Caddyfile
sascha pushed to main at sascha/pfannkuchen 2026-04-24 17:29:24 +02:00
b5ca1048b7 Add git.sascha-lutz.de, remove patchmon.sascha-lutz.de
sascha pushed to main at sascha/homelab-butler 2026-04-22 21:39:14 +02:00
e8bd80fb3c Update README: v2.1.1 with DELETE /vm/destroy lifecycle cleanup
sascha pushed to main at sascha/homelab-butler 2026-04-22 21:32:49 +02:00
6f165ccb2c Fix vm_destroy: Use vm/list endpoint for reliable VM info + IP extraction
sascha pushed to main at sascha/homelab-butler 2026-04-22 21:30:46 +02:00
3b37c639a2 Fix vm_destroy: Handle Proxmox API response formats (list vs dict)
sascha pushed to main at sascha/homelab-butler 2026-04-22 21:28:02 +02:00
e79f7256b5 Add DELETE /vm/destroy/{vmid} - complete lifecycle cleanup (v2.1.1)
sascha pushed to main at sascha/homelab-butler 2026-04-22 21:25:17 +02:00
de6f053088 Update README: Add v2.1.0 changelog (SOPS + .env automation)
sascha pushed to main at sascha/homelab-butler 2026-04-22 21:20:20 +02:00
8fe5bbd069 Add SOPS + .env automation after ansible/run
sascha pushed to main at sascha/homelab-butler 2026-04-22 20:56:38 +02:00
6f9e1a47dd Fix: Sync Hawser token to Dockhand after ansible/run
sascha pushed to main at sascha/homelab-butler 2026-04-22 19:42:29 +02:00
db28775b51 v2.1: butler.yaml config, OpenAPI, /status, /audit, dry-run
sascha pushed to main at sascha/homelab-butler 2026-04-22 19:42:29 +02:00
9348a0cdc6 v2.1: butler.yaml config, OpenAPI, /status, /audit, dry-run
sascha pushed to main at sascha/homelab-butler 2026-04-22 19:42:29 +02:00
659f3d5ca8 v2.1: butler.yaml config, OpenAPI, /status, /audit, dry-run
sascha pushed to main at sascha/homelab-butler 2026-04-22 19:42:29 +02:00
1439557293 v2.1: butler.yaml config, OpenAPI, /status, /audit, dry-run
sascha pushed to main at sascha/homelab-butler 2026-04-22 18:28:30 +02:00
a0ef1054cd docs: comprehensive README with all endpoints
sascha pushed to main at sascha/homelab-butler 2026-04-22 18:27:57 +02:00
c875e2b185 feat: VM lifecycle, TTS, inventory endpoints
sascha pushed to main at sascha/homelab-butler 2026-04-22 18:27:57 +02:00
0296809864 feat: VM lifecycle, TTS, inventory endpoints